HELLO!’s ORIGINAL COVER GIRL THE PRINCESS ROYAL FAMILY’S HEARTFELT TRIBUTES AHEAD OF HER 70 TH BIRTHDAY

She was HELLO! ’s first cover star, taking readers inside her apartments in Buckingham Palace in 1988. More than 30 years on, the Princess Royal is still one of the royal family’s most respected and admired members.

She regularly tops the list of most hardworking royals and clocked up an impressive 506 engagements last year, surpassed only by her big brother the Prince of Wales with 521.

And as she approaches her 70th birthday next month, Princess Anne shows no sign of relaxing her pace.
